The global Digital Agriculture market size in 2022 is 13140.0 million US dollars, and it is expected to be 24802.4 million US dollars by 2029, with a compound annual growth rate of 9.50% expected in 2023-2029.

MARKET COMPETITIVE LANDSCAPE:
The main players in the Digital Agriculture market include DTN (US), Farmers Edge Inc. (Canada), Taranis (US), Eurofins Scientific (Luxembourg), and AgriWebb (Australia). The share of the top 3 players in the Digital Agriculture market is XX%.
